2. 创建一个SHA1加密类 现在,我们可以创建一个名为SHA1Encryptor的类来实现SHA1加密。这个类将包含一个用于计算SHA1 Hash值的方法。 publicclassSHA1Encryptor{// 省略类的其他部分} 1. 2. 3. 3. 编写一个方法来计算SHA1 Hash值 接下来,我们将在SHA1Encryptor类中编写一个方法来计算SHA1 Hash值。我们将...
SHA1 SHA1 在线HASH加密
在Java中使用SHA1加密算法 Java提供了内置的SHA1加密算法实现,我们可以使用Java提供的MessageDigest类来进行SHA1加密。 以下是使用Java实现SHA1加密的代码示例: importjava.nio.charset.StandardCharsets;importjava.security.MessageDigest;importjava.security.NoSuchAlgorithmException;publicclassSHA1EncryptionExample{publicstat...
hashsha1等hash加密方式的基本加密方式.go / Jump to Go to file 19 lines (16 sloc) 386 Bytes Raw Blame package main import ( "crypto/md5" "fmt" ) func main() { hash := md5.New() //返回的是一个已经实现过接口的了的struct,所以才可以直接使用。 b := []byte{} n, err :...
这里只做 SHA1 加密: //////基于Sha1的自定义加密字符串方法:输入一个字符串,返回一个由40个字符组成的十六进制的哈希散列(字符串)。(x2:字母小写,X2字母大写)//////要加密的字符串///<returns>加密后的十六进制的哈希散列(字符串)</returns>publicstringSha1(stringstr) {varbuffer =Encoding.UTF8.G...
sha1 sha 加密 itertools import hashlib import itertools a1 = "1!" a2 = "2@" a3 = "eshcn" for j in itertools.combinations(a1,1): for k in itertools.combinations(a2,1): str = j[0]+k[...
文字在线加密解密、散列/哈希、BASE64、SHA1、SHA224、SHA256、SHA384、SHA512、MD5、HmacSHA1、HmacSHA224、HmacSHA256、HmacSHA384、HmacSHA512、HmacMD5、urlencode、urldecode
* @brief 使用HMAC-SHA1算法生成oauth_signature签名值 * * @param $key 密钥 * @param $str 源串 * * @return 签名值 */ 1 function getSignature($str, $key) { 2 $signature = ""; 3 if (function_exists('hash_hmac')) { 4 $signature = bin2hex(hash_hmac("sha1", $str, $key, true...
腾讯云 API 全新升级 3.0 ,该版本进行了性能优化且全地域部署、支持就近和按地域接入、访问时延下降...
对官方CRYPTO(加密与解密) 功能的复现,进行相关内容的学习及探讨。 实现功能 功能1:常用加解密操作及hash函数; 功能2:RSA加密解密(RSA1024、RSA2048); 硬件准备 Air103开发板1块。 软件版本 AIR103:LuatOS@AIR105 base 22.11 bsp V0011 32bit 软件使用 ...